Back to Resources
Article

Enabling Dynamic Report Subscriptions in Power BI

Subscribe users to filtered report views and personalized emails.

Power BI subscriptions can send an email with a snapshot or link to a report on a schedule. “Dynamic” usually means the recipient or the filter applied to the report is driven by data (e.g. each sales rep gets their region).

Options

Use Power Automate to loop over a list of recipients (or filters), call the Power BI export or link API per recipient, and send personalized emails. That gives you dynamic subscriptions beyond the built-in “one subscription per user” limit.

Respect RLS so each recipient only gets data they’re allowed to see; run the flow with the right context or use per-user APIs where possible.

Need help with your migration?

Our team can help you design, build, and optimize your Power BI and Fabric solutions.

Get a free assessment

Ready to modernize your BI stack?

Stop maintaining legacy workbooks. Start leveraging the full power of the Microsoft Data Platform today.